Immard is a medication containing hydroxychloroquine sulfate, a drug with established uses in treating certain medical conditions. It’s available in tablet form, typically as film-coated tablets of 200mg. The primary function is as an antimalarial agent, effectively combating the parasitic infection that causes malaria. However, its therapeutic applications extend beyond this, making it a versatile medication.
Beyond malaria, Immard demonstrates efficacy in managing specific autoimmune disorders. Its immunomodulatory properties play a crucial role in this context. This means it can help regulate the body’s immune response, reducing the inflammation and tissue damage characteristic of these conditions. This is particularly relevant in diseases like rheumatoid arthritis and lupus.

Immard’s active ingredient, hydroxychloroquine, works through a multifaceted mechanism to achieve its therapeutic effects. While the exact details aren’t fully elucidated for all its applications, key aspects of its action are well-understood. One crucial aspect involves its impact on lysosomes, the cellular organelles responsible for waste breakdown.
Hydroxychloroquine alters the function of lysosomes, specifically affecting their membranes. This interference leads to a reduction in the release of damaging enzymes from these organelles. This effect is particularly relevant in inflammatory processes, where the uncontrolled release of lysosomal enzymes contributes to tissue damage. By stabilizing lysosomal membranes, hydroxychloroquine helps to curb this destructive process.
Furthermore, Immard demonstrates effects on the immune system. It’s believed to modulate the immune response, reducing excessive inflammation. This action is pivotal in autoimmune diseases where the immune system mistakenly attacks the body’s own tissues. By dampening this aberrant immune activity, Immard helps to alleviate symptoms and prevent further tissue damage.
In its antimalarial action, hydroxychloroquine interferes with the parasite’s life cycle. Specifically, it inhibits the parasite’s ability to utilize hemoglobin, a crucial protein for its survival. This disruption of the parasite’s metabolic processes ultimately leads to its death, effectively treating the malarial infection. The precise mechanisms by which hydroxychloroquine achieves these effects are areas of ongoing research.
Immard’s primary therapeutic application lies in its effectiveness against malaria, a life-threatening parasitic disease prevalent in many parts of the world. It’s particularly useful in treating malaria caused by Plasmodium vivax, Plasmodium ovale, and Plasmodium malariae. However, it’s not effective against all forms of malaria, and its use should always be guided by a healthcare professional’s assessment.
Beyond its antimalarial properties, Immard finds significant use in managing certain autoimmune disorders. Its ability to modulate the immune system makes it a valuable tool in controlling inflammation and reducing associated symptoms. Conditions where Immard has shown therapeutic benefit include rheumatoid arthritis, a chronic inflammatory condition affecting the joints, and syst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E), a more widespread autoimmune disease.
In treating rheumatoid arthritis, Immard helps to alleviate pain, stiffness, and swelling in the affected joints. Its use in SLE aims to control the systemic inflammation characteristic of this condition, improving overall patient well-being. However, it’s important to note that Immard is often used in conjunction with other therapies for optimal management of these autoimmune diseases. It’s not a standalone treatment but rather a valuable component of a comprehensive approach.

While Immard offers therapeutic benefits, it’s crucial to acknowledge potential drawbacks. One significant consideration is the possibility of side effects, which can vary in severity and frequency among individuals. These side effects can range from mild gastrointestinal discomfort to more serious issues, underscoring the importance of close medical supervision.
Retinopathy, a condition affecting the retina of the eye, is a potential, albeit rare, serious side effect associated with long-term use of hydroxychloroquine. Regular eye examinations are recommended, especially for patients on prolonged treatment, to detect any early signs of retinopathy. Early detection is crucial for effective management and prevention of vision impairment.
Furthermore, Immard’s use can be associated with drug interactions. Certain medications can interact negatively with hydroxychloroquine, potentially reducing its effectiveness or increasing the risk of side effects. It’s vital to inform your doctor about all other medications, supplements, or herbal remedies you’re taking to prevent such interactions. While generally well-tolerated, Immard can cause various side effects. The most common are usually mild and transient, including gastrointestinal issues such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, or abdominal pain. These are often manageable and may subside as the body adjusts to the medication. Staying well-hydrated and maintaining a balanced diet can help.
Some patients may experience headaches, dizziness, or fatigue. These symptoms are usually mild and don’t necessitate immediate medical attention. However, if they persist or worsen, it’s crucial to consult your doctor. They can assess the severity and determine if adjustments to the treatment plan are necessary.
More serious, though rare, side effects include retinopathy, affecting the retina of the eye, and blood disorders. Regular eye examinations are recommended, particularly for patients on long-term treatment, to monitor for any signs of retinopathy. Prompt detection allows for timely intervention.
Skin reactions, such as rashes or itching, can also occur. If you experience any unusual skin changes while taking Immard, it’s advisable to contact your doctor immediately. They can assess whether the reaction is related to the medication and advise on appropriate management.
